Family Name: The surname 狄 ('Dí') originates from the Di tribe, an ancient ethnic group in northern China. According to historical records, it may trace back to the Ji clan of the Zhou Dynasty, as descendants of Duke Xiao were granted land in Di City and adopted the place name as their surname. Another theory links it to the Mi clan, tracing its roots to the royal family of the Chu State.
Given Name: Butterflies symbolize lightness and freedom, while 'lan' refers to the mist in the mountains, embodying elegance, freedom, and natural freshness.
